The Power of Empathy in Building Strong Social and Emotional Relationships
Empathy is the ability to understand and share the feelings
of others. It is a vital component in building strong social and emotional
relationships as it allows us to connect with others on a deeper level and
respond to their needs in a compassionate and supportive manner.
1. To develop empathy, we must first learn to recognize and
acknowledge our own emotions. By understanding our own feelings, we can better
understand and relate to others' emotions. We can also practice active
listening, as it allows us to fully engage with the speaker and understand
their perspective.
2. Another way to cultivate empathy is to put ourselves in
others' shoes. By imagining what it would be like to experience what they are
going through, we can better understand their perspective and respond with more
sensitivity and understanding.
3. Finally, it is important to show empathy through our
actions. Small acts of kindness and support can go a long way in building
strong social and emotional relationships. By showing that we care about
others' well-being and are willing to support them, we can create a positive
dynamic in our relationships.
In conclusion, empathy is a powerful tool for building strong social and emotional relationships. By understanding our own emotions, practicing active listening, imagining others' perspectives, and showing empathy through our actions, we can develop deeper and more meaningful connections with those around us.
